Humane Society of Mason County Shelter Services Assistant Belfair, WA · Part time

The Humane Society of Mason County is a quickly growing organization, with a strong focus to provide the best services possible to local pet owners and animals in need. With departments growing so quickly the Shelter Services Assistant position has been created to assist various departments within the organization where help is needed.

Description

Essential Job Functions

  1. Assist with Customer service in our front office. 
  2. Assist foster or medical staff when needed with animal handling. 
  3. Assist in  transport of foster animals to partner organizations, appointments, events, ect. 
  4. Work closely with foster coordinator and vet staff to help provide ongoing support and guidance to foster families, including assistance with medical care, behavior management, and emotional support.
  5. Data input to help maintain accurate records of animals in foster care and monitor their progress.
  6. Provide top customer service to the HSMC foster families, respond to emails, Facebook posts and phone calls from foster parents in a timely manner and resolve issues as they arise
  7. Initial health tests, vaccinations, and treatment for internal and external parasites. 
  8. Adoption outreach to promote adoptable animals in foster homes. 
  9. Provide top customer service to HSMC volunteers, fosters, clinic clients, and adopters. 
  10. Assist with medical appointments and procedures with vet staff.
